Old English Houses by J Alfred Gotch
Attractive as old English houses are from their appearance, their beauty is not their only claim on our attention, for they illustrate the long story of domestic architecture, which goes back to the time when men first built in this country with permanent materials. In the following pages, an attempt is made to relate the outline of that story in words that will be understood by readers unfamiliar with the subject.
With 7 plates and 48 illustrations.
